Transaction 81fcc00b771ed04ce3fee150a57dde8526822df8df279eacb8533b1c6f683b98
1 Input
1 Output
-
81fcc00b771ed04ce3fee150a57dde8526822df8df279eacb8533b1c6f683b98: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d6a9de74922f5e5a9316349c0b9c9b9eeb7d5dee38707ec54e714c615f5c1e3a
- address
- bc1p665auayj9a094yckxjwqh8ymnm4h6h0w8pc8a32ww9xxzh6urcaqvpm5p7